Bridging finance refers to temporary funding designed to cover short-term capital requirements. This financial mechanism provides liquidity during transitional periods, facilitating the completion of a subsequent, larger transaction. In the digital asset landscape, it can address interim liquidity gaps or enable asset transfers between disparate blockchain networks. Such arrangements are crucial for maintaining operational continuity and optimizing capital deployment across varied digital ecosystems.
Context
The digital asset domain continually explores bridging finance solutions to enhance interoperability between blockchains, a persistent challenge for cross-chain transactions. Innovations aim to reduce friction and cost in these transfers, thereby supporting a more interconnected decentralized finance environment. The security and reliability of these bridging mechanisms remain central to their broader acceptance and utility within the crypto sphere.
